Good Morning, Surfers

Saturday
Waves this morning are running in the thigh- to waist-high range with bumpy conditions from a steady southeasterly wind. Bigger waves are running in the Satellite Beach area.

Sunday
I don’t expect much change for Sunday. Waves should continue in the thigh-high range with slightly cleaner conditions from an expected onshoe breeze. This may be the last of rideable waves as a long period flat spell is in my forecast.

Cocoa Beach ocean temperatures now average 84 degrees.

ABOUT THE AUTHOR

Bob-Freeman-180-2Bob Freeman has been surfing Brevard’s waves since 1966. He was also the first to surf several of North Carolina’s remote islands in the mid ’60s and travels frequently to surf in Puerto Rico, Costa Rica, Mexico and Hawaii. He provided his first surf reporting and weekend forecasts in 1968 live on WKKO radio from the RonJon Surf Shop on Cocoa Beach Pier. He was the 1968 Florida Men’s Surfing Champion and is the current Florida Legend’s Surfing Champion. He has gathered over 300 amateur 1st place awards in both shortboard and longboard divisions. He is a 2014 Inductee into the Space Coast Sports Hall of Fame.
